Photo Flash: New Musical FREEDOM'S SONG in Rehearsal
A staged reading of the new musical Freedom's Song will be presented June 9 at 9 PM at the Tada Theatre on 28th and Broadway in Manhattan. Check out rehearsal photos below!
Written by Alison Holman and Caleb Collins, the reading is part of The Emerging Artists Theatre's New Works Festival.
Directed by Steven Carl McCasland, the cast will be led by Jennifer Hope Wills, Rod Singleton, Dwayne Washington, Siobhan Roland, Trevor McQueen, Matthew Martin, Jeffery Wilsor and MJ Rodriguez.
The ensemble includes Brian Childers, Joya Richmond, Kimberly Faye Greenberg, Tiffany Renee Thompson, Tim Hein, Elora Dannon Rosch, Yvette Bedgood, Sydney Van Putten Geovonday Zachary Jones, TJ Bolden, Lawrence Neals, Daniel Walstad, Abigail Ludrof, Danny Wilfred, Lynda DeFuria, Chauncey Packer, Kayla Leacock and Tatiana Wechsler.
The evening will also feature musical direction by Collins and Holman.
